Beneath the Law on Nine-Year Obligatory Education, Most important colleges had been to get tuition-cost-free and reasonably Positioned for that advantage of youngsters attending them; pupils would attend Major faculties within their neighborhoods or villages. Dad and mom paid a little cost for each phrase for textbooks together with other charges like transportation, meals and heating. Previously, expenses weren't viewed as a deterrent to attendance. Beneath the education reform, college students from poor families been given stipends, and state enterprises, institutions, and also other sectors of society were being inspired to determine their very own schools.

Attempts produced in 1975 to further improve educational quality were being unsuccessful. By 1980, it appeared doubtful which the politically oriented admission standards had completed even the goal of escalating enrollment of employees and peasant kids. Profitable candidates for university entrance had been commonly kids of cadres and officers who utilized particular connections that authorized them to "enter through the again doorway." College students from officials' family members would settle for the requisite minimal two-yr do the job assignment within the countryside, generally inside of a suburban place that authorized them to remain close to their households.

The caliber of larger education in modern day China has modified at various here situations, reflecting shifts while in the political policies applied from the central authorities. Following the founding with the PRC, in 1949, the Chinese government's educational aim was largely on political "re-education". In periods of political upheavals, such as the Good Step forward and the Cultural Revolution, ideology was stressed above Specialist or complex competence. During the early stages on the Cultural Revolution (1966–1969), tens of Many school college students joined Crimson Guard organizations, which persecuted numerous university school associates as "counter-revolutionaries" and proficiently closed China's universities. When universities reopened inside the early nineteen seventies, enrollments were being diminished from pre-Cultural Revolution stages, and admission was limited to individuals who had been recommended by their do the job device (danwei), possessed very good political credentials, and experienced distinguished on their own in manual labor.
